Safer fish

Below is a list of the safer, and more dangerous, fish you can consume (taken from Oceans Alive, part of the Environmental Defense Network).  Unsafe fish are often high in mercury and PCBs and should be completely avoided by pregnant women, young children, and those trying to conceive.  Fish is the primary means of exposure [...]

How exercise affects the brain

Here is an interesting article from the New York Times entitled “Phys Ed: Why Exercise Makes you Less Anxious.”  A few interesting tid-bits to motivate you to work out more in 2010: Exercise stimulates the formation of new brain cells.
